The circadian lighting tag on WindowsForum.com covers discussions about smart home automations that adjust lighting based on the time of day to support natural sleep-wake cycles. Content highlights how Home Assistant can be used to create automations that mimic natural daylight patterns, improving comfort and well-being. The tag focuses on practical implementations, such as integrating circadian lighting into broader home automation systems, and emphasizes the role of logic and scheduling in creating a cohesive smart home environment. This tag is relevant for users interested in health-focused lighting, Home Assistant automations, and smart home customization.
